Versatility in Tube Processing

One of the standout features of the tube cutting laser system is its versatility. Traditionally, tube cutting has been a complex and time-consuming process, requiring multiple setups and tools to achieve the desired results. With the new laser system, manufacturers can streamline their operations by consolidating the cutting process into a single, efficient workflow.

From automotive components to structural elements, the tube cutting laser system can be utilized across a wide range of industries and applications. Its ability to cut through various materials, including steel, aluminum, and copper, makes it a versatile solution for manufacturers looking to enhance their production capabilities.
